Music video director Chen Ying Zhi’s (陳映之) gets together with Deserts Chang for the song Significant Others (兩者), written by her and composed by Sodagreen’s Wu Tsing-Fong (吳青峯), who appears in the music video as Narcissus alongside Taiwanese actress Janine Chang (張鈞甯).
Deserts Chang has released an alternate version of her latest single Threat (危險的,是), off of her latest albums Games We Play (神的遊戲), directed by Lin Yifeng (林益鋒).
Deserts Chang has just released Rose-colored You (玫瑰色的你), from her fourth album titled Games We Play (神的遊戲), directed by Lo Ging-Zim (羅景壬).
